Jacob Schmidt
aad36ddd8d Return bank existence lookup errors to callers
- Make `bank_exists` surface backend/UID resolution failures instead of returning `false`
- Add SQF guard to log and alert on unexpected existence responses
- Prevent duplicate/default bank records after failed lookups
2026-05-21 22:39:22 -05:00
Jacob Schmidt
788ac6da7a Throttle mission generation and quiet status logs
- Add a mission generation cooldown in the mission manager
- Suppress noisy task status extension logs
- Switch task and entity class hashes to merged base copies
2026-05-21 21:56:50 -05:00
